Distillation should be done steadily and at such a rate that the thermometer bulb always carries a drop of condensate and is bathed in a flow of vapor . ... However, sugar molecules do not leave the solution, and the drop clinging to the thermometer bulb is pure water in equilibrium with pure water vapor.

What will happen if the bulb of the thermometer is too low or too high?

If it is too low, it will be too close to the boiling liquid and will read higher than the true vapor temperature . If it is positioned too high, it will be out of the path of the vapors and read lower than the true temperature. This is too low.

Why must the thermometer bulb be placed opposite the mouth of the condenser?

the bulb of the thermometer is opposite the exit to the condenser. You want the temperature of the exit vapours since it is these that will condense. the delivery bend is vented so that when the apparatus is heated the joints aren’t pushed apart by expanding gas.

Q: How far down the stillhead should the thermometer bulb be placed when setting up the distillation apparatus? The mercury bulb of the thermometer should be positioned so that vapors condense readily on it . The tip of the bulb should be in line with the lowest part of the connecting tube of the stillhead.

Simple Distillation Summary

Always use an extension clamp on the distilling flask. Add a few boiling stones or stir bar to flask. Position the thermometer bulb just below the arm of the three-way adapter , where vapors turn toward the condenser.

Why is the thermometer not placed directly in the liquid?

If we have the thermometer placed at the top of the column, there’s no way that it could be measuring the temperature of the solution . It’s simply too far away. Instead, it will be able to measure the temperature of the vapor after the liquid begins boiling, becomes a gas, and makes its way up through the column.

What does it mean if the thermometer temperature suddenly drops in the middle of your distillation?

The temperature drops because the lower-boiling compound finishes distilling before vapors of the higher-boiling compound can fill the distillation head, which then cause the head temperature to rise .

Why is a slow drop rate important in distillation?

A one mL per minute rate (or slower) is recommended for best results in a fractional distillation; simple can go faster. Slow, gradual distillation essentially allows the best equilibration and heat transfer . If you heat too fast, vapors may not condense as quickly as desired, and may waste some of the column.

How far should the bulb of a thermometer go down the distillation head?

The entire bulb of the thermometer must be positioned below the bottom of the arm leading to the condenser . This ensures that the entire bulbis immersed in the rising vapors and that the temperature is accurate 5.

What is the reading on the thermometer during distillation?

In the top of this connector is the thermometer, which is used to read the temperature of the vapor , just as it condenses. The temperature reading is important, because, at normal conditions, the temperature of the vapor passing through is the same as the boiling point of the substance being collected.
